A new family-owned orthodontic practice, RuCo Orthodontics, has opened its doors in Smyrna, Tennessee, aiming to provide accessible, patient-focused care for children, teenagers, and adults. The practice, led by Dr. Anish Gala and Dr. Sasha Baston, offers a full range of treatment options including traditional braces, clear aligners, and early orthodontic intervention.
RuCo Orthodontics was founded on the principle that quality orthodontic care should be approachable for every patient, regardless of age or background. The practice offers bilingual services, allowing Dr. Gala and Dr. Baston to communicate directly with patients and families in more than one language — an intentional design choice reflecting the diversity of the Smyrna community. The practice offers traditional braces, clear aligners, and early orthodontic treatment for younger patients. Early intervention is available for children who may benefit from treatment before all permanent teeth have erupted. For teens and adults, clear aligners provide a discreet alternative to traditional hardware, an option that has grown in demand among patients preferring a less visible treatment path.
